Divide and Conquer Redesign
Designers Liz and Rick O'Leary separated the rectangular space into two rooms: one for the his-and-her sinks and claw-foot soaking tub, the other for the shower and toilet. To open it up even more, an adjacent dressing closet was reworked with a doorway into the bath, creating an uninterrupted sight line from the closet's dresser at one end to the raised tub at the other to the bucolic scene out the new window bay. Two entrances from the bedroom create a circular flow; white woodwork and warm beige walls, plus plenty of windows—six in all—give the compact rooms an airy, open feeling. Says O'Leary: "You always have something to look at, so you never feel like you're at a dead end." -
